The FDA label advises that "the developmental and health benefits of breastfeeding should be considered along with the mother's clinical need for tirzepatide and any potential adverse effects on the breastfed infant from tirzepatide or from the underlying maternal condition." This guidance places decision-making responsibility on the healthcare provider and patient, requiring individualized risk-benefit assessment
